Prince Chukwudi Oli unveils bold blueprint for DNA Constituency

Chukwudi Oli

A legal practitioner of repute, Prince Chukwudi Oli has stepped forward as a leading aspirant to represent Dunukofia, Njikoka, and Anaocha Federal Constituency under the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A), promising a new era of accountable, people-driven leadership.

Speaking to newsmen about his ambition at his countryhome in Nri, in Anaocha LGA, an emotional Oli expressed deep conviction about his journey and mission, describing his candidacy not as a quest for power, but a deliberate call to serve.

“I have always been intentional in everything I do,” he said, emphasizing that his ambition is driven by capacity, not sentiment or political entitlement.

The constituency—one of the largest in Nigeria, comprising 51 wards and hundreds of polling units across the three local governments—holds a special place in his heart.

While acknowledging the contributions of past representatives, Oli insists that the time has come for a shift toward transformational leadership.

“I am not the kind of leader who seeks to elevate himself above the people,” he declared. “I am a servant leader.

My mission is to serve with the resources meant for the people and to ensure that every kobo is accounted for.”

Oli pledged to openly disclose all constituency allocations and involve citizens directly in decision-making through regular town hall meetings.

“When the people know how much comes in, and they decide how it is spent, corruption has no place.”

Drawing from his legal expertise, Oli also promised effective lawmaking driven by grassroots engagement.

He stressed that understanding the real needs of the people is key to drafting impactful legislation.

“My experience in litigation, corporate law, and legislative processes gives me a clear advantage over other aspirants.

“I will sit with my people. We identify our priorities, and translate them into laws and projects that improve lives,” he assured.

On the issue of zoning, which has sparked debates within the constituency, Oli maintained a firm stance: leadership should be based on competence and vision.

While respecting all opinions, he urged constituents to prioritize capacity over sentiment.
